About the Role:

Community Nurse (Oncology)


Youll provide safe, compassionate care to oncology patients in the comfort of their own homes.

What you'll do:



Providing pre chemo blood sampling Monitoring patients and updating care records. Escalate concerns when needed. Promote patient health and independence Work closely with other professionals as part of a team Working with patients, families, and other healthcare professionals Supporting health and wellbeing

Youll Need:



Active NMC registration Minimum 3 years post-registration experience PICC line and venepuncture competency (essential) Port a Cath access experience (essential) within the last 6 - 12 months Full UK driving licence and access to a vehicle Right to work in the UK (sponsorship not available)

Desirable:



Oncology nursing experience

About HomeLink Healthcare




HomeLink Healthcare is a

clinician-led

, patient-focused organisation delivering high-quality Hospital at Home services in

partnership with the NHS

since 2016. Also working in conjunction with some of Londons finest

private healthcare partners

. Our skilled teams of

nurses, therapists and caregivers

help patients leave hospital sooner, avoid admission or receive planned private treatment, by providing exceptional care in the comfort of their own homes.
